DEV Community

Cover image for O que é o código ASCII?
GDH Press
GDH Press

Posted on

O que é o código ASCII?

Pronunciado ask-ee, ASCII é o acrônimo para o Código Padrão Americano para Intercâmbio de Informações. É um código para representar 128 caracteres em inglês como números, com cada letra atribuída um número de 0 a 127. Por exemplo, o código ASCII para letras maiúsculas M é 77. A maioria dos computadores usa códigos ASCII para representar texto, o que torna possível a transferência de dados de um computador para outro.

Os arquivos de texto armazenados em formato ASCII são às vezes chamados de arquivos ASCII. Os editores de texto e processadores de texto são normalmente capazes de armazenar dados em formato ASCII, embora o formato ASCII nem sempre seja o formato de armazenamento padrão. A maioria dos arquivos de dados, particularmente se eles contêm dados numéricos, não são armazenados em formato ASCII. Os programas executáveis nunca são armazenados em formato ASCII.

O conjunto de caracteres padrão ASCII

O conjunto padrão de caracteres ASCII utiliza apenas 7 bits para cada caractere. Há vários conjuntos maiores de caracteres que utilizam 8 bits, o que lhes dá 128 caracteres adicionais. Os caracteres adicionais são usados para representar caracteres não-ingleses, símbolos gráficos e símbolos matemáticos.

Várias empresas e organizações propuseram extensões para estes 128 caracteres. O sistema operacional DOS usa um superconjunto de ASCII chamado ASCII estendido ou ASCII alto. Um padrão mais universal é o conjunto de caracteres ISO Latin 1, que é usado por muitos sistemas operacionais, assim como navegadores da Web.

Outro conjunto de códigos que é usado em grandes computadores IBM é o EBCDIC.

Tabela ASCII
Alt Text

Fonte:
https://www.twilio.com/blog/2015/12/ascii-art-via-text.html
https://gdhpress.com.br/tabela-ascii-completa-pdf/

Top comments (0)